Senior Firmware Engineer

5 days ago


Singapore X-PHY Inc Full time

Senior Firmware Engineer - Secure SSD & Embedded Security As X-PHY continues to expand, we are looking for a senior firmware engineer to take on the role of team lead for our firmware group. This position blends hands‐on embedded firmware development with technical leadership and strategic oversight. You will lead a dedicated team in design, development, and optimization of firmware for cybersecure hardware products, working closely with hardware, FPGA, and cybersecurity engineers to deliver secure, high‐performance, real‐time firmware systems on ARM and FPGA platforms. Responsibilities Lead the firmware development lifecycle—from architecture and design to implementation, validation, and deployment. Guide and mentor junior engineers; perform technical reviews and help grow team capabilities. Design, develop, and maintain low‐level firmware and device drivers for ARM and FPGA‐based embedded platforms. Collaborate with hardware and FPGA engineers to define system architecture and interface layers. Work on secure boot processes, BSPs, and diagnostic firmware for secure SSDs and other hardware. Implement cybersecurity measures such as encryption, secure key storage, and tamper detection in firmware. Oversee firmware testing infrastructure including unit testing, integration testing, and CI support. Interface with other engineering leads (software, hardware, FPGA, QA) to align schedules, requirements, and product goals. Contribute to system performance tuning and optimization. Stay up-to-date with best practices in embedded security, real‐time processing, and secure firmware updates. Qualifications Bachelor's or Master's degree in Electrical Engineering, Computer Engineering, Computer Science, or related discipline. 7+ years of experience in firmware or embedded software development, with at least 2 years in a technical leadership role. Proficient in C/C++, with additional experience in Python for scripting and testing. Strong experience with ARM architectures (e.g., Cortex‐A/M) and SoC platforms. Expertise in firmware‐hardware interaction, device drivers, memory‐mapped I/O, and BSPs. Experience developing for and integrating with FPGAs using Verilog/VHDL. Deep understanding of real‐time operating systems (RTOS) and/or embedded Linux environments. Familiarity with hardware protocols including PCIe, I2C, SPI, UART, and DDR. Hands‐on debugging experience using tools such as JTAG, oscilloscopes, and logic analyzers. Proven ability to lead complex technical projects across multiple teams. Preferred Qualifications Experience with secure embedded systems: secure boot, encryption, key management. Knowledge of cybersecurity principles, threat models, and countermeasures. Familiarity with AI/ML deployment on embedded platforms (e.g., anomaly detection via lightweight neural networks). Experience with Git‐based workflows, CI/CD pipelines, and build systems like Yocto or Buildroot. Experience with NVM (non‐volatile memory) systems and custom SSD firmware development. Benefits Performance Bonus tied to results. Restricted Stock Units (RSUs). Career advancement opportunities. Collaborative work environment. Location and Availability This is a full‐time on‐site role based in Singapore. Only candidates who are currently based in Singapore or open to relocating will be considered. #J-18808-Ljbffr



  • Singapore X-PHY Full time $120,000 - $180,000 per year

    X-PHY is an industry leader in cybersecurity technology, delivering cutting-edge solutions that proactively protect businesses from evolving cyber threats. As a hardware-based cybersecurity company, we don't just build products—we build the future.As we continue to expand, we're seeking passionate, driven individuals to join our mission to redefine...


  • Singapore GMP Group Full time

    **Responsibilities**: - Develop large embedded firmware or software for medical and other mission-critical systems - Involve in entire firmware development lifecycle including requirement engineering, architectural design, coding, testing and maintenance - Design and develop firmware to realize new solutions - Assume overall responsibility for the delivery...


  • Singapore PERCEPT SOLUTIONS PTE. LTD. Full time

    We are seeking a Senior Firmware Engineer to contribute to the development and maintenance of our Programmable Logic Controllers (PLCs). This role involves designing and implementing new features, resolving software issues, and ensuring high-quality deliverables within a global, cross‑functional team environment. Key Responsibilities Develop and maintain...


  • Singapore ENVIRODYNAMICS SOLUTIONS PTE. LTD. Full time

    **Join the Gobal Team and be part of their product development**: - **Career Growth Opportunity**: - **Competitive Compensation Package** We are looking for Senior/Staff Firmware Engineers for developing our Next Generation Industrial Automation products. **Experience - Have strong knowledge and experienced in developing embedded software using **C/...


  • Singapore BRADY SINGAPORE PTE. LTD. Full time

    Job DescriptionThe Senior Firmware Engineer is responsible for designing and writing high quality code to support the development of the company's hardware products. The engineer will need to read schematics, read datasheets, and utilize both hardware and software debugging tools in order to complete projects. The engineer is expected to participate in the...


  • Singapore PERCEPT SOLUTIONS PTE. LTD. Full time

    Roles & Responsibilities We are seeking a Senior Firmware Engineer to contribute to the development and maintenance of our Programmable Logic Controllers (PLCs). This role involves designing and implementing new features, resolving software issues, and ensuring high-quality deliverables within a global, cross-functional team environment. Key...


  • Singapore Micron Full time

    **Our vision is to transform how the world uses information to enrich life for all.** Join an inclusive team passionate about one thing: using their expertise in the relentless pursuit of innovation for customers and partners. The solutions we build help make everything from virtual reality experiences to breakthroughs in neural networks possible. We do it...

  • Firmware Engineer

    2 weeks ago


    Singapore AVETICS GLOBAL PTE. LTD. Full time

    Job Description & Requirements We are seeking for a motivated Firmware Engineer to join our team! As a Firmware Engineer, you will be responsible for supporting the firmware development team in designing, developing, and testing firmware for a microcontroller on our products. You will be responsible for full-stack firmware development from design to...

  • Senior Engineer

    2 weeks ago


    Singapore Micron Full time

    **Our vision is to transform how the world uses information to enrich life for all.** Join an inclusive team passionate about one thing: using their expertise in the relentless pursuit of innovation for customers and partners. The solutions we build help make everything from virtual reality experiences to breakthroughs in neural networks possible. We do it...


  • Singapore HYPERSCAL SOLUTIONS PTE. LTD. Full time

    **COMPANY DESCRIPTION** Beyondsoft International (Singapore) Pte. Ltd. was set up in 2007 and established as the regional headquarters for the Southeast Asia (SEA) and European markets in September 2015. Based on our vision of "Using technology to promote social progress, economic development and become a global customer preferred partner" and our concept of...